The journey towards a pest totally free home begins with a thorough and expert home evaluation. Termites are infamously sneaky, often getting in structures through small cracks in concrete pieces or through concealed mud tunnels built along the foundations. A standard visual check by a house owner is hardly ever sufficient to discover an early stage invasion. Qualified pest service technicians make use of advanced technology such as thermal imaging cameras, wetness detection meters, and acoustic sounding equipment to find active nests without disrupting the home. This preliminary stage is crucial since it determines the exact species involved and the degree of the movement, which dictates the layout of the ultimate management strategy.
As soon as the assessment is complete, the focus shifts to picking the most appropriate interception and elimination methods. Among the most trustworthy strategies used in Canberra termite treatment is the installation of a treated liquid soil zone around the border of the structure. Professionals thoroughly use a specialized non repellent liquid to the soil surrounding the structures. When foraging bugs move through this dealt with zone, they do not discover the existence of the chemical. Instead, they bring the active components back to their main nest on their bodies. Through natural social grooming and feeding habits, the treatment spreads out throughout the whole population, ultimately neutralizing the source of the invasion.
For residential or commercial properties where extensive concrete courses or intricate architectural styles make soil trenching difficult, keeping track of and baiting systems provide an excellent alternative. This methodology involves positioning protected, low profile bait stations at tactical intervals around the lawn. These stations are filled with a highly attractive cellulose matrix that brings in foraging pests away from the primary building. Professionals check these points on a strict schedule. As quickly as activity is kept in mind, the matrix is enhanced with a sluggish acting development regulator that avoids the insects from molting, which eventually leads to the collapse of the whole colony.

In addition to employing specialists, constant maintenance and preventive habits function as an important safeguard for any property owner. Given that termites thrive on moisture, simple upkeep can drastically decrease the opportunity of an invasion. Directing hot‑water overflow drains and air‑conditioning condensate far from your home walls is an outstanding first procedure. Owners need to also avoid putting timber, fire wood, or cardboard against outside walls and keep garden mulch listed below the damp‑proof course, avoiding the development of a simple bridge for the pests.
